Output 72881d3eb96590985e2710f23a7a54abfff31cd03e89c2cd8a12411b501195a2:12

value
25954622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ae404d0afc6a49966b6e065b11cfecd325988c OP_EQUAL
address
MQ6eaZuMjnpxqn7YPFPSqKi3xruj2irNTd
transaction
72881d3eb96590985e2710f23a7a54abfff31cd03e89c2cd8a12411b501195a2
spent
true